Program areas at Bikes Together
143 bikes were distributed through our Bicycle Distribution Program through community partnerships with non profit organizations.
Redistributed almost 937 refurbished and recycled bicycles in the Denver community through our programs and physical locations
The Learn& Repair and Pay-What-You-Wish and While-You-Wait programs enabled over 826 bike repairs with the assistance of skilled volunteers and professional staff using Bikes Together tools and work stands.
Bikes Together Social enterprise shop sold 546 reduced cost professionally refurbished bikes and provided 1,275 low cost professional repairs. Bikes Together bike shops provide access to bikes, bike parts and service in a community that would not otherwise have local access to these services
